Out of Time

An atmospheric modern "film noir" with Denzel Washington as a police chief in a small Florida town who is romantically involved with Sanaa Lathan, a woman married to abusive husband Dean Cain. When Lathan needs money to pay for experimental cancer treatments, Washington steals $500,000 in drug loot held by his department. But after a mysterious fire kills Lathan and Cain, Washington becomes the prime suspect in their deaths - and faces homicide detective Eva Mendes, his soon-to-be ex-wife, in the investigation.
